Frequently Asked Questions about Echeveria Agavoides Romeo Rubin
- How big will my Echeveria Agavoides Romeo Rubin be when it arrives? Your plant will be a single head, approximately 2 to 2.5 inches in diameter, shipped bare root without a pot or soil to ensure safe transit.
- What kind of soil does this Echeveria need? For optimal growth, use a well-draining succulent or cactus potting mix. Good drainage is crucial to prevent root rot.
- How often should I water my Echeveria Agavoides Romeo Rubin? Water thoroughly only when the soil is completely dry. In most environments, this could be every 2-4 weeks, but always check the soil moisture before watering.
- Can I keep this succulent outdoors? Yes, the Echeveria Agavoides Romeo Rubin is versatile and can thrive outdoors in appropriate climates (USDA Zone 9-11) or be brought indoors during colder months.
- What kind of light does the ‘Romeo Rubin’ prefer? This succulent loves bright, direct sunlight for at least 6 hours a day to maintain its vibrant red coloration. If kept indoors, place it near a south-facing window or under a grow light.
